Abstract
1,148,756. Sulphur. B. GRUETER. 11 June, 1966, No. 26122/66. Heading C1A. [Also in Divisions B1 and C5] Hydrogen sulphide and mercaptans are removed from hydrocarbon-containing gas streams, especially from natural gas which also comprises methane, nitrogen and carbon dioxide, by pressure washing with a C 1-5 -trialkyl phosphate at temperatures up to 40‹ C., the ester being subsequently regenerated by depressurization in one or more stages, preferably with heating to 50-150‹ C. The washing is suitably performed at pressures of 40-80 atmospheres and depressurization may be effected in two stages. The preferred regeneration temperature is 100‹C., and regeneration may be assisted by passing a current of an inert or purified gas through the liquid. In one embodiment, especially suitable where the H 2 S content is high a natural gas stream is pressure washed and then passed through a bed of Type 5A molecular sieve to complete its purification. Part of the purified stream is used to regenerate an exhausted bed of molecular sieve, the effluent stream therefrom being recycled with the crude gas stream. In a second embodiment, suitable for use with a lower H 2 S content, the natural gas stream is purified by passage through a molecular sieve bed. Part of the purified effluent stream is passed through an exhausted second bed to regenerate it, and the effluent therefrom, of high sulphur content, is passed through a pressure wash before being recycled with the feed stream. The regeneration temperature for the molecular sieve bed is at least 200‹ C., and is preferably 250-400‹C. The sulphurcontaining gas stream obtained by regenerating the washing agent may be processed in a Claus plant to give elemental sulphur.
